#d8fe05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8fe05 is composed of 84.7% red, 99.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 69.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d8fe05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#b1f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d8fe05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8fe05 has RGB values of R:216, G:254,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0. Its decimal value is 14220805.

Shades and Tints of #d8fe05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030400 is the darkest color, while #fdffef is the lightest one.
